There are a variety of advantages to hiring a handyman to complete projects and repairs around the house. Most property owners underestimate the amount of time it will require to research study, prepare, total, and clean up from a task. If the time isn't readily available, off-loading the project to a specialist can be an excellent choice.
Property owners who acquire tools for a single task are investing money for items that may simply collect dust in the garage for many years after the job is complete. House owners may be able to total basic jobs after enjoying videos and reading instructions, but for more complex tasks, the finished job might look unpolished.
Even if you're not composing a check, there is a cost to the Do it yourself method: Repetitive journeys to the home enhancement shop can result in purchases made in mistake that can't be returned, and "attempt it and see" attempts can lead to more patch-up work. In addition, even with careful research, an unskilled homeowner may have the ability to complete the task, however as a first-timer, the finish will look less refined and professional than the work a skilled handyman would produce.
DIY requires research study, planning, purchasing, prep, conclusion of the actual job, and clean-up. It's most likely that, unless the homeowner actually takes pleasure in the work and does it often, working with a handyman might be less costly than the time invested doing it yourself. For larger tasks, those requiring specialized tools, and those requiring permits and examination, house owners can conserve time, money, and trouble by employing a handyman with more experience and a stock of products and tools.

A handyman is somebody who will have access to your house, so it is very important to ensure you've done your research. The primary step after collecting suggestions is to inspect your state's licensing requirements so you know what to request. Check your state's licensing requirements for licensing handymen. Some states only need licensing for specific kinds of jobs or for jobs costing over a particular quantity.
Picking the best handyman isn't simply a matter of certifications; property owners require to be comfy with the expert they're letting into their house. Regional real estate agents can be excellent sources: Due to the fact that they frequently deal with repair work that require to be made prior to a sale, they tend to understand numerous of the local handymen by reputation and experience.
Once you have actually identified potential prospects, safe and secure quotes for the work from numerous of them in writing. This will assist develop a sense of what the extremes are in terms of cost, and it may help you comprehend each handyman's design based upon how they propose to do the work and their time frame.
